"A few months ago I found a leak in what I thought was our septic system in our backyard. It smelled like sewage and was near our tank so seemed like a reasonable assumption. We have a pool and lots of concrete and for some reason our septic tank is underneath all this concrete near the pool (was this way since we moved in). I had a few different plumbers come out and take a look. Nearly all of them took one quick look at it and immediately decided it would be just as expensive to tear up all the concrete getting to the septic tank and field lines just to figure out where the leak was. So they all recommended just installing a new tank. In a way they were all correct, it would have cost a fortune to get to the tank. But when Shane came out and checked the leak he suggested that he spend a little time digging where the leak was in case he found it quickly. He thought it might be a field line leaking that wasn't buried as far away from the grass as the tank and might be accessible. He did agree that if he couldn't find the leak in the first couple of feet then it would be best just to go ahead and install a new tank. I should add that his quote for installing the new tank was the best I found, plus he said he would not charge me for the extra work looking for the cause of the leak if he didn't find it. When he and his two co-workers came out they started by digging out the area where the leak was as well as digging a few yards away from the concrete in hopes of finding a field line leading to the leak. They spent about 2 hours working on finding the leak and eventually they did. it turned out the leak was not from the septic system at all! Our kitchen sink and washing machine (possibly dishwasher too) had a separate line not connected to the septic system that had broken and was leaking. Shane fixed the leak and installed a new field line for this separate line and our problem has been solved. It was still an expensive fix (about $5000), but he saved us at least $4000 ($9000 was the cheapest quote for our new tank installation and re-routing plumbing). Not only that, but had we had a new tank installed, we would have spent that $9000 and still had the same leak! Shane was the only person who even made the suggestion to take a closer look where the leak was. All the other plumbers just immediately decided I needed to install a new tank. So we could have ended up spending nearly 10k (or even more depending on which plumber we chose) on a new tank, then another 5k on fixing the real issue! And let's not even get started on the fact that our whole side yard would have been torn up as part of the new tank installation (the field lines he installed were in back in an area that we didn't care as much about). So I can't thank Shane enough for being sensible and suggesting spending just an hour or so diagnosing the problem before jumping into a super expensive fix! I would for sure recommend Rapid Rooter again!"
